
Men's Tennis Falls at No. 36 Dartmouth, 6-1
4/15/2016 12:00:00 AM | Men's Tennis
HANOVER, N.H. – The Brown men's tennis team was defeated at No. 36 Dartmouth, 6-1, at the Boss Tennis Center on Friday. Sophomore Aaron Sandberg (Hudson, Ohio) posted a win for the Bears in singles' play.
The Big Green won the doubles point, taking the victories in the first and second matches.
In singles play, sophomore Peter Tarwid (Lake Forest, Ill.) had a tightly contest first set against No. 81 Dovydas Sakinis, but was edged 7-6. Sakinis then went on to win the match in the next set (6-1). Sandberg's win came in fifth singles, a 6-4, 6-0 triumph.
The Bears will next return home to the Brown Varsity Tennis Courts on Sunday, April 17, to host No. 48 Harvard, with the Ivy League match starting at 1:00 p.m.
